The 3CD ‘Chorus’ features a re-mastered version of the original album; a selection of remixes, B-sides and bonus tracks and a live version of the album, recorded on Erasure’s Phantasmagorical Entertainment Tour. ‘Chorus’, the band’s fifth album, was released in 1991 and was shortlisted for the Mercury Music Prize the following year. It gave Erasure their third Number One album and includes the Top 5 singles “Love To Hate You”, “Chorus” and “Breath of Life” along with the band’s 15th consecutive Top 20 hit, “Am I Right?”
